Houses
When looking at Mclellans Brook houses for rent or a detached house for rent, prioritize layout, yard space and storage. Houses often include private outdoor areas, driveways and more flexible pet policies, so confirm responsibilities for lawn care, snow clearing and repairs in the lease.
Request a clear list of included utilities and ask about average monthly costs. For semi-detached and detached options, inspect sound transfer at shared walls and confirm parking arrangements before signing.
Condos
Condos in Mclellans Brook can offer lower maintenance living and shared amenities. When searching for Mclellans Brook condos for rent or apartments for rent in Mclellans Brook, review the condo corporation rules, fees, and any renter requirements the board enforces.
Clarify what the rent covers versus what you pay directly (hydro, internet, parking) and ask whether amenities like laundry or storage are included. Verify access to building entries and emergency procedures.
Townhomes
Townhomes for rent in Mclellans Brook combine townhouse privacy with compact maintenance. For Mclellans Brook townhomes for rent, check who is responsible for exterior upkeep and shared driveways or laneways.
Because townhomes often sit in tighter clusters, assess neighbour proximity, noise potential and visitor parking. Confirm lease clauses about alterations, subletting and assignment if you anticipate changes during your tenancy.

Frequently Asked Questions
What documents are typically required for a rental application?
Landlords commonly request a government ID, proof of income (pay stubs or employment letter), references from previous landlords, and a credit check or rental history. Having these ready speeds up approval for Mclellans Brook rentals.
How long are typical lease lengths in the area?
Leases often range from month-to-month to one year. Fixed-term leases of six or 12 months are common; review renewal terms and termination notice periods before you sign to ensure the lease matches your plans.
Can rent increase during my lease?
Rent increases depend on the lease terms and provincial rules. A signed fixed-term lease usually locks rent for that term; month-to-month agreements may allow changes with proper notice. Always review the lease clauses on rent adjustments.
Which utilities are usually included in rent?
Inclusions vary—some listings cover heat and hot water, while others exclude hydro, internet and propane. Confirm which utilities the landlord pays and which you’re responsible for so you can budget accurately.
Are pets allowed in Mclellans Brook rentals?
Pet policies differ by landlord and property type. Ask about breed or size restrictions, additional pet deposits or monthly pet fees, and any rules about outdoor areas. Get pet permissions in writing as part of the lease.
What should I expect during an inspection or move-out walkthrough?
Inspections document the condition of the rental at move-in and move-out. Take photos and note any issues on the move-in report to avoid disputes over the security deposit. During move-out, follow cleaning and repair expectations outlined in the lease.
